The correct answer is- yes human is keystone species.
Explanation:
The keystone species are the species that help so many other species to grow in a evosytem. In other words, a species on which several other species depends on are keystone species
Humans are considered as hyper keystone as they play a major role in any ecosystem from forest to land to ocean in so many different ways.
